Which document is the primary input for identifying risks to be included in a quantitative risk analysis?

Correct answer & explanation

Risk Register.

The Risk Register, developed during the Qualitative Risk Analysis phase, identifies the risks that are prioritized for further quantitative study.

Option-by-option breakdown

For each option: why learners choose it and why it is or isn't the right answer here.

  • Risk Register.

    Why this is correct

    The Risk Register contains the identified risks required for analysis.

  • Stakeholder Engagement Plan.

    Why it's wrong here

    This focuses on communication, not risk data.

  • Lessons Learned Repository.

    Why it's wrong here

    Useful for identification, but the Risk Register is the formal input.

  • Project Charter.

    Why it's wrong here

    The Charter is too high-level for specific risk quantification.
